Hi if you look at the https://devcentral.f5.com/wiki/iRules.pool.ashx you will see a syntax for pool which let's you select not only a pool, but a pool member from that pool. The expected behaviour of
pool [LB::server pool] member $member 80
is to select the member denoted by the IP in $member on port 80 (I assumed 80). It's superior to using the node command as it will look at the status of the member within the pool [LB::server pool] (which is just the currently selected pool), and if it's marked down will immediately throw LB_FAILED rather than (with node, where it's not aware of the member status) waiting until syn retransmit limit is hit before deciding the node cannot be reached.
Try adding in the following logging statements while you troubleshoot;-
when LB_FAILED {
log local0. "[HTTP::uri] [LB::server]"
}
when LB_SELECTED {
log local0. "[HTTP::uri] [LB::server]"
}
